Solution for 7(n-9)= equation:


Simplifying
7(n + -9) = 0

Reorder the terms:
7(-9 + n) = 0
(-9 * 7 + n * 7) = 0
(-63 + 7n) = 0

Solving
-63 + 7n = 0

Solving for variable 'n'.

Move all terms containing n to the left, all other terms to the right.

Add '63' to each side of the equation.
-63 + 63 + 7n = 0 + 63

Combine like terms: -63 + 63 = 0
0 + 7n = 0 + 63
7n = 0 + 63

Combine like terms: 0 + 63 = 63
7n = 63

Divide each side by '7'.
n = 9

Simplifying
n = 9
